Proceedings and Language

All papers, presentations, discussions and recommendations of the Conference will be in English. All papers will be subjected to a process of peer review before acceptance. While all accepted papers will be duplicated for distribution at the conference, only a selection of "full papers" and "short papers" will be published, after revision, in the Conference book. The book will normally be published by Springer Publishers as a special volume in accordance with the high standards associated with IFIP publications. A copy of this Springer publication will be distributed to each Conference participant, when printed approximately six months after the Conference. Papers will be published only if authors are present at the conference.

The Programme Committee will make decisions regarding the acceptance of submitted papers for presentation at the Conference. Following recommendations by the Programme Committee, the Editors will make final decisions regarding acceptance for publication in the Proceedings. Such decisions will be final and authors concerned will be notified separately by the editors.
